案例分享 | Lumerical助力CompoundTek光柵耦合器面積大幅縮減
總覽
客戶:CompoundTek(硅光全球Foundry服務提供商)
所使用的產品:FDTD,Automation API
應用領域:光子集成器件和電路
CompoundTek是一家新興全球硅光(SiPh)半導體解決方案Foundry服務的領導者,致力于提供能滿足高帶寬、高數據傳輸解決方案的開創性半導體應用。該公司的專業技術實現了從專有制造工藝技術到面向終端產品制造設計支持的全面覆蓋。
為了持續向需要快速設計和制造光子集成電路的研發人員提供高度靈活的解決方案,CompoundTek不斷探索新方法,改進開發流程,以提高組件性能、降低成本、提高產量和工程效率,并縮短設計周期。隨著商業化光子行業對上市速度的要求越來越高,Lumerical和CompoundTek開展密切合作,共同探索能改進硅光(SiPh)光柵耦合器(最復雜的光子器件之一)的新方法。雙方積極探索,不僅著手于縮短設計周期,而且還著重將組件尺寸縮小至最低水平,降低終端用戶的成本。
采用Photonic Inverse Design設計使面積縮小20倍的光柵耦合器
結合Lumerical行業領先的FDTD納米光子仿真器,Lumerical的光子逆向設計(PID)流程可被用于對新型光柵耦合器進行設計和優化。Lumerical的PID使光子設計人員能夠快速開發出性能更佳、面積更小、制造工藝更為穩健的優化功能。PID幫助光柵耦合器設計人員實現可靠的、具有數百個自由參數的優化設計的自動生成,最大限度地提高設計分辨率。
Lumerical的2020a版中引入了新的功能,加強了對云平臺運行FDTD和PID的支持。該版本包含Job checkpointing、支持Amazon Linux、FDTD Burst Packs的在線自動激活等特性。全局優化功能等其它顯著的PID特性,讓設計人員能夠高效探索廣闊的設計空間,針對工藝和封裝變化開展聯合優化,實現穩健的制造可變性設計。
在兩周的設計時間內,Lumerical的PID流程在亞馬遜云服務(AWS)的EC2平臺上成功運行,充分的發揮了其靈活性、成本效益的優勢和近乎無限的可擴展功能。對于在整個設計周期中具有可變性的工作負載,計算資源可以隨時擴展,而無需像內部平臺那樣預先支付高昂的IT成本。這在設計后期尤其具有吸引力,因為此時需要大幅增強仿真能力,以快速優化和驗證設計的多種變量。

對兩種光柵耦合器的原始設計和新設計的插入損耗進行對比,并采用2D FDTD開展仿真
在AWS EC2上使用Lumerical的PID流程,成功開發的新型SiPh光柵耦合器,其器件面積比CompoundTek的現有耦合器小20倍,性能預計也會有所改善。為實現上述成果,PID流程經配置后,可在具有超過50多項設計參數的FDTD中自動優化光柵耦合器的參數化2D模型。優化目標是在整個頻帶上最大限度地降低損耗,同時把強制的特性約束控制在最低水平,以確保可制造性。圖2為在C頻段和O頻段的TE模式下,優化設計后FDTD仿真的損耗與原始耦合器的比較。在C頻段,預計性能與原始設計相當,在1550-nm處的損耗為-2.5dB。在O頻段,經優化的耦合器的預計性能有所提高,在1310-nm處的損耗為-2.4dB。對于CompoundTek的客戶而言,在提升耦合器性能的同時實現如此大幅度的面積縮減是難能可貴的,因為這樣有望降低制造成本。
通過在AWS EC2上開發設計PID,生成和優化光柵耦合器設計所需的時間被縮短到兩周,其中包括配置和啟動云資源所需的時間。利用Lumerical應用庫中提供的2D光柵耦合器示例作為參考設計并取得Lumerical的FDTD Burst Pack許可,可以實現在幾個小時內就能生成備選設計。
兩周后,CompoundTek獲得了8種可制造變量的最佳設計,這些設計的尺寸顯著小于現有設計,且在整個頻段上性能更佳,特別是在O頻段的性能也有顯著提高。
完成為期兩周的設計項目所需的計算總成本約為250美元,這是通過利用EC2的spot pricing(競價實例)實現的。通過在AWS上完成該項目,避免了部署和維護本地計算資源等大量前期成本、可能的延誤和后續維護成本。項目完成后,只需關閉AWS EC2,釋放占用資源,就不會產生進一步的費用。
關于CompoundTek
CompoundTek 是一家由行業資深人士和技術人員創立并運營的新加坡企業,融世界一流的商業代工廠與領先的硅光子(SiPh)研究機構于一身,致力于通過尖端的 SiPh 技術來提高晶圓代工廠的服務能力。CompoundTek 面向市場推出了開創型的半導體應用,旨在滿足高帶寬和高數據傳輸解決方案的關鍵要求,尤其是在推動工業 4.0 的新興連通性方面。
工程師必備
- 項目客服
- 培訓客服
- 平臺客服
TOP




















